Final: Делаем подарки.

This commit is contained in:
Igor Barkov [iwork] 2019-01-28 18:15:24 +02:00
parent 04a7aa6287
commit 540e5bace9
2 changed files with 5 additions and 4 deletions

View File

@ -72,7 +72,7 @@ if (!empty($user['realname'])) echo "Имя: " . $user['realname'] . "<br>";
while ($row = $presents_new->fetch_assoc()) while ($row = $presents_new->fetch_assoc())
if (empty($row['sender'])) $sender = 'Анонимный подарок'; if (empty($row['sender'])) $sender = 'Анонимный подарок';
else $sender = 'Подарок от ' . $row['sender']; else $sender = 'Подарок от ' . $row['sender'];
echo "<img src=i/presents/{$row['img']} class='tooltip' title='Подарок от {$sender}'>"; echo "<img src={$row['img']} class='tooltip' title='Подарок от {$sender}'>";
?> ?>
</div> </div>
<?php endif; ?> <?php endif; ?>

View File

@ -52,9 +52,10 @@ if (!empty($_POST['sendAction'])) {
else $from = $user['login']; else $from = $user['login'];
db::c()->query('UPDATE `users` SET `money` = `money` - ?i WHERE `id` = ?i', $cost, $_SESSION['uid']); db::c()->query('UPDATE `users` SET `money` = `money` - ?i WHERE `id` = ?i', $cost, $_SESSION['uid']);
db::c()->query('INSERT INTO users_presents (owner, img, text, sender, expiration_date) VALUES (?i,"?s","?s","?s",DATE_ADD(NOW(),INTERVAL ?i DAY))', $receiver['id'], $_POST['present'], $_POST['text'], $_POST['from'], $_POST['days']); db::c()->query('INSERT INTO users_presents (owner, img, text, sender, expiration_date) VALUES (?i,"?s","?s","?s",DATE_ADD(NOW(),INTERVAL ?i DAY))', $receiver['id'], $_POST['present'], $_POST['text'], $_POST['sender'], $_POST['days']);
$deloText = "{$user['login']} купил подарок за {$cost} кр. и подарил его персонажу {$_POST['receiver']}"; #FIXME Я так не хочу подключать functions!
addToDelo($deloText); // $deloText = "{$user['login']} купил подарок за {$cost} кр. и подарил его персонажу {$_POST['receiver']}";
// addToDelo($deloText);
$telegraphText = "Вам пришёл подарок от {$from}!"; $telegraphText = "Вам пришёл подарок от {$from}!";
db::c()->query('INSERT INTO `telegraph` (receiver, text) VALUES (?i,"?s")', $receiver['id'], $telegraphText)->fetch_assoc(); db::c()->query('INSERT INTO `telegraph` (receiver, text) VALUES (?i,"?s")', $receiver['id'], $telegraphText)->fetch_assoc();
$status = "Подарок удачно доставлен к {$_POST['receiver']}! Вы потратили <b>{$cost}</b> кр."; $status = "Подарок удачно доставлен к {$_POST['receiver']}! Вы потратили <b>{$cost}</b> кр.";